
ICAR-Directorate of Medicinal and Aromatic Plants Research (ICAR-DMAPR) Hosts 3-Day Kisan Mela in Anand, Gujarat
Anand: The Kisan Mela organized by ICAR-Directorate of Medicinal and Aromatic Plants Research (ICAR-DMAPR) in Anand, Gujarat, kicked off on January 22, 2024, with the inauguration by Dr. Himanshu Pathak, Secretary, DARE and DG, ICAR. The event, spanning three days until January 24, 2024, encompassed a Herbal Expo, Farmers Training, and an Exposure visit.
Key Highlights:
The Kisan Mela concluded with three best stall awards and significant participation from farmers, school children, and visitors. The event acted as a valuable platform for knowledge exchange, technology adoption, and fostering partnerships in the agricultural sector.
